Teaching Interactions of Black and Cuban Teenage Mothers and their Infants.
De Cubas, Mercedes M.; Field, Tiffany
Early Child Development and Care, v16 n1-2 p41-56 1984
Provides descriptive data on mother/infant interaction in two ethnic and maternal age groups. Participants were 32 lower-income Black and Cuban-American, teenage and adult mothers and their 12-month-old infants. Cuban-American mothers demonstrated a task with verbalization significantly more often than did Black mothers. Adult mothers showed a more internal locus of control than did teenage mothers.
